EV Auto Show Accelerates Riyadh’s Drive Toward a Smarter, Greener Future
Riyadh – The fourth edition of the EV Auto Show opened with great enthusiasm at the Riyadh International Convention and Exhibition Center, marking another milestone in Saudi Arabia’s commitment to a sustainable and technologically advanced future.
Running from October 27 to 29, 2025, the event showcases the Kingdom’s growing leadership in electric mobility and highlights how innovation, infrastructure, and industry collaboration are reshaping transportation in line with Vision 2030.
This year’s show brought together more than 120 exhibitors from 35 countries, all showcasing the newest models, advanced charging systems, and smart mobility solutions.
The exhibition emphasized local manufacturing, workforce development, and sustainability, reflecting Saudi Arabia’s focus on becoming a global hub for electric vehicle innovation.
The country’s ambitious goal is to make 30 percent of all vehicles in Riyadh electric by 2030 — a key step in cutting carbon emissions by 50 percent in the capital.
As consumer interest continues to rise, new research by PwC Middle East shows that nearly 40 percent of Saudis are considering buying an electric vehicle within the next three years.
The government’s proactive policies, major infrastructure investments, and public-private partnerships are paving the way for this transition.
Faisal Sultan, President of Lucid Motors in the Middle East, noted the significant progress the Kingdom has made in developing its EV ecosystem.
“Saudi Arabia now has a strong structure to support the EV market,” he explained. “Over the past two years, the formation of the EV Infrastructure Company by the Public Investment Fund has created the foundation for rapid growth.
We are collaborating closely with them and other private players to give consumers more options in the next few years.”
He also highlighted Lucid’s contribution to charging accessibility across Riyadh. “We’ve installed chargers in hotels and parking lots that are free to use. This kind of convenience will make owning an electric vehicle easier and more practical for everyone,” he said.
Juan Carlos, CEO of SIXT, praised the Kingdom’s progress in developing its charging infrastructure. “Riyadh now has more charging stations than we have in Madrid,” he remarked.
“The level of support from the government and the pace of development here are impressive. It’s clear that Saudi Arabia is serious about creating a smart mobility ecosystem that is efficient, sustainable, and accessible.”
He added that SIXT has one of the largest rental EV fleets in Saudi Arabia and plans to expand further to meet growing demand.
The expansion of the public charging network has been remarkable — more than 200 charging locations are already operational, with plans to reach over 1,000 stations by 2030.
This infrastructure will ensure that electric vehicle owners can travel across the Kingdom with ease, supporting both daily commuters and long-distance travelers.
The event also featured exciting product launches and global debuts. ROX Motor introduced its luxury all-terrain SUV, the ROX ADAMAS, to the Saudi market following its global unveiling in Abu Dhabi.
Lucid Motors presented its new Gravity SUV, further expanding the range of high-performance electric vehicles available to consumers.
Leading brands such as BYD, Tesla, Chery, Jaecoo, iCAUR, and SIXT also showcased their latest innovations, demonstrating the growing diversity and competitiveness of the EV sector.
Beyond exhibitions, the EV Auto Show served as a hub for collaboration and learning. Industry experts, policymakers, and innovators came together to discuss opportunities in manufacturing, infrastructure development, fleet operations, and sustainable financing.
Attendees also had the opportunity to test-drive a variety of electric and plug-in hybrid vehicles, allowing them to experience firsthand the advancements in performance, technology, and design.
